Cleaning and care To remove a grease filter, release the locking clip. Then, open the filter to a 45° angle, unhook it, and remove it from the hood. Cleaning the grease filters by hand Clean the filters with a soft nylon brush in a mild solution of hot water and dish soap. Do not use undiluted dish soap. Unsuitable cleaning agents Unsuitable cleaners can cause damage to the filter surfaces if used regularly. Do not use any of the following: - Lime removers - Abrasive powders or abrasive liquids - Aggressive all-purpose cleaners and degreaser sprays - Oven sprays Cleaning the grease filters in the dishwasher Place the filters as upright or inclined as possible in the lower basket. En‐ sure that the spray arm is not ob‐ structed. Use a common household dishwash‐ er detergent. Select a program with a wash tem‐ perature between 122°F (50°C) and 149°F (65°C). In a Miele dishwasher use the "Normal" program. Depending on the detergent used, cleaning the filters in a dishwasher may cause the inside filter surfaces to become discolored. However, this will not affect the functioning of the filters in any way. After cleaning After cleaning, leave the filters on an absorbent surface to dry. When removing the filters for clean‐ ing, also clean off any accessible oil or fat buildup from the housing. Do‐ ing so will prevent a fire hazard. Reinstall the grease filters. When in‐ serting the filters, make sure that the locking clip is facing down. 28
